What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
The Domestic Short Hair cat is highly adaptable and can thrive in various living environments, from spacious homes to cozy apartments. They are content with indoor living and enjoy having comfortable places to relax.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Domestic Short Hair cats do not require outdoor space, as they are perfectly satisfied being indoor pets. However, they do appreciate access to windows or safe balconies to observe the outdoors.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Domestic Short Hair cats are generally well-suited for families with children. Their playful and easygoing nature makes them great companions for kids who treat animals gently.
